Review:
Zodiac
is an Enterprise wheel, located in Lost City. Riders sit either
individually or in twos in individual carriages which are affixed
to the side of the wheel. There are no restraints to keep you
in your seat, which makes you feel very vunerable. The wheel
starts to rotate and the arm supporting the wheel rises, until
the wheel is perpendicular to the ground. You are now riding
upside down in your carriage. The centrifugal force keeps you
tight in your seat, which is quite a feeling. There is no need
for a restraint!
Zodiac
is a good ride because it makes you feel quite insecure. As with
all Theme Park rides, it is actually very safe, but you can't
but help feel daunted by it. It's a good ride for couples, or
for a parent and child to ride together. However, it is not that scary,
or thrilling. It's a sensation, which just makes you dizzy.
